Table 3.

Activation energy of the CNCs, calculated by the three methods in the range of a = 0.1 to 0.8.

Conversion Rate Friedman F-W-O Coats-Redfern
E (KJ/mol) a R2 E (KJ/mol) a R2 E (KJ/mol) a R2
0.1 242.6 (±0.2) 0.9959 239.0 (±0.2) 0.9955 242.7 (±0.2) 0.9952
0.2 289.9 (±0.1) 0.9972 285.2 (±0.2) 0.9971 291.2 (±0.2) 0.9968
0.3 302.2 (±0.3) 0.9999 299.4 (±0.2) 0.9996 305.9 (±0.2) 0.9995
0.4 304.9 (±0.3) 0.9984 302.3 (±0.1) 0.9974 308.9 (±0.1) 0.9972
0.5 305.3 (±0.3) 0.9976 295.0 (±0.2) 0.9984 300.8 (±0.2) 0.9982
0.6 311.7 (±0.3) 0.9836 304.8 (±0.1) 0.9721 310.8 (±0.1) 0.9704
0.7 356.1 (±0.3) 0.9899 343.0 (±0.1) 0.9721 350.5 (±0.2) 0.9769
0.8 387.9 (±0.3) 0.9933 353.5 (±0.1) 0.9782 360.9 (±0.1) 0.9973
Mean 312.6 (±0.3) 0.9945 302.8 (±0.2) 0.9888 309.0 (±0.2) 0.9914

E: Apparent energy of activation; a: Values from CNCs with standard deviation.
